Head of Continuous Improvement

Location: Sittingbourne

Salary: £60,000 - £70,000

Benefits:

  • 25 days holiday + Bank holidays.
  • Company pension.
  • Health care.
  • Bonus.
  • Flexible working available.

Schedule: Monday - Friday (8am - 4pm or 9am - 5pm)

Position Overview:

This position as Head of Continuous Improvement is a brilliant opportunity to join an established, and growing manufacturing business which operates globally. Our client is seeking a skilled and experienced Head of Continuous Improvement or Continuous Improvement Manager to join their team and establish different procedures and practices to drive efficiency across multiple sites.

Position Duties:

  • Develop and implement continuous improvement strategies aligned with business objectives.
  • Champion a culture of operational excellence and lean thinking throughout the organisation.
  • Identify opportunities for process optimisation, cost reduction, and performance enhancement.
  • Lead cross-functional projects focused on process standardisation, efficiency, and waste reduction.
  • Utilize Lean, Six Sigma, and other methodologies to analyse processes and implement improvements.
  • Establish key performance indicators (KPIs) to measure the effectiveness of continuous improvement initiatives.
  • Provide coaching, training, and development to staff on continuous improvement tools and techniques.
  • Foster an environment that encourages innovation and proactive problem-solving.
  • Collaborate with department heads to identify areas for improvement and develop action plans.
  • Communicate continuous improvement goals and progress to senior leadership and key stakeholders.

Position Requirements:

  • International travel to sites on occasion.
  • Strong knowledge of Lean, Six Sigma, Kaizen, and other process improvement methodologies.
  • Strong leadership, communication, and stakeholder management abilities.
  • Proven experience in a leadership role focused on continuous improvement, process optimisation, or operational excellence.
  • Lean Six Sigma certification (Black Belt preferred).
